Forbidden Dreams (1987)

Leo Popper is a happy family man living in rural Bohemia in the years preceding the Nazi invasion. Out of economic necessity he moves with his family to the big city and becomes an enterprising vacuum cleaner salesman. There he embarks on a series of adulterous adventures, has encounters with boxing pros and famous portrait artists, and schemes to purchase the perfect pond to fulfill his passion for fishing. When the Nazis gain control, the comedy turns sour - he loses his lake, his job, and finally, his family.

Director: Karel Kachyňa
Genre: Comedy, Drama
Runtime: 91 min

Music: Luboš Fišer
Cinematography: Vladimír Smutný
Editing: Jiří Brožek
Production: Filmové studio Barrandov
Country: Czechoslovakia

Who stars in Forbidden Dreams?
Forbidden Dreams stars Karel Heřmánek, Marta Vančurová, Rudolf Hrušínský, Jiří Krampol, Lubor Tokoš, Dana Vlková.
